💬 Interview Questions

What is one of the specific questions they asked you?

What are global impacts of veterinary medicine?

What was the most interesting question?

What do you know about horse slaughter?

What was the most difficult question?

Explaining the abbreviation of a surgery

How did you prepare for the interview?

This website, otherwise notecards with possible questions

What impressed you positively?

The staff is very nice and helpful and respond to emails almost immediately.

What impressed you negatively?

Nothing, I left with OSU becoming my number 1 choice.

What did you wish you had known ahead of time?

People always say the same thing, but I really do wish I hadn't stressed so much because the interview process is made to try and make you feel comfortable, while getting a sense of who you are.
